Failure to get Weather

Open griffinmt opened this issue 1 year ago • 2 comments

After finally getting a new ili9488 and have it working with your software (thanks!!), I cannot get your TFT_eSPI_Weather app to work. And it always shows as Feb 7. What have I forgot to do this time?

griffinmt avatar Nov 13 '22 18:11 griffinmt

Run the My_DarkSkyWeather_Test example to see if the weather service is working. You may need to pay to access the data as I hink DarkSky is not longer free.

This library is deprecated and is just here for legacy reasons, so OpenWeather may be a better option.Signing up for an access API key is free with OpenWeather.
